Foy again for Clarets

Last updated : 10 November 2006 By Tony Scholes
The game at the Windy City was an easy game to referee but Foy's had something of a difficult time since that Stoke game, just a couple of weeks later he got a decision wrong in the Tottenham v Portsmouth game that led to him being suspended from the Premiership.

He awarded Spurs a penalty, and that proved to be their winning goal, for a supposed foul by former Spurs player Pedro Mendes on Didier Zokora but it was the most blatant of dives that he'd missed. Barnsley's Paul Heckingbottom proved to be the ultimate loser, Foy was demoted to their game at Sheffield Wednesday and he sent him off.

Heckingbottom is the only player he's sent off this season whilst he's waved his yellow card 36 times in 14 games. Of those 36 cards, 16 of them have gone to home players and the other 20 to away players.

He's had some shockers refereeing Burnley, and our first game of the new Millennium at Notts County stands out, as does his handling of the opening day game against Crystal Palace in the 2003/04 season. He's also had some decent games and hopefully tomorrow will be similar to Stoke in September, the same result would be good too.

He will be assisted by Adam Watts (Worcestershire) and Andy Williams (Herefordshire) whilst Andrew Sainsbury (Wiltshire) will be the fourth official.
